Metal Roofs And Hail – Protecting Your Home From Storm Damage
Metal roofs generally offer superior resistance to hail compared to traditional asphalt shingles, often minimizing or preventing significant damage.
However, the extent of impact depends on factors like the metal type, gauge (thickness), panel profile, and hailstone size and density.

The Science of Hail Impact
Hailstones, essentially chunks of ice, fall with considerable force. Their impact creates a localized stress point on any surface they hit. On a brittle material like asphalt, this can cause cracks, delamination, or granule loss.
Metal, however, behaves differently. It’s a ductile material, meaning it can deform under stress without fracturing. This flexibility allows it to absorb impact energy more effectively than rigid materials.
Factors Influencing Durability
Not all metal roofs are created equal when it comes to standing up to hail. Several key factors play a crucial role in how well your roof will perform.
- Metal Type: Different metals have varying hardness and malleability. Steel and aluminum are common choices. Steel, especially galvanized or galvalume steel, is very strong. Aluminum is lighter and softer, making it more prone to denting but still highly durable. Copper and zinc are also excellent but less common due to cost.
- Gauge (Thickness): This is perhaps the most critical factor. The gauge refers to the thickness of the metal sheet. A lower gauge number means a thicker sheet. Thicker metal (e.g., 24-gauge or 26-gauge steel) is significantly more resistant to denting from hail than thinner options (e.g., 29-gauge).
- Panel Profile and Installation: The shape of the metal panels also matters. Standing seam panels, with their raised seams, often have hidden fasteners and a more rigid structure, which can help distribute impact force. Corrugated or ribbed panels, with their undulating surfaces, also add structural strength, though the flat sections are still vulnerable.
- Coatings and Finishes: While primarily for aesthetics and corrosion protection, some textured coatings can offer a minor buffer against smaller hail. However, their primary role isn’t impact resistance.
Common Types of Metal Roofing and Their Hail Performance
The world of metal roofing offers a variety of styles and configurations. Each type has its own characteristics when facing a hail assault. Understanding these differences can help you set realistic expectations.
Standing Seam Metal Roofs
These are arguably the gold standard for metal roofing. They feature flat panels with interlocking seams that rise vertically, hiding fasteners and providing a sleek, modern look. Performance against hail: Standing seam roofs, especially those made from 24-gauge or 26-gauge steel, are highly resistant to hail damage. The rigidity of the panels and the way they’re installed make them very resilient. They may still dent from large hailstones, but these dents are often cosmetic and don’t compromise the roof’s integrity or weatherproofing.
Corrugated and R-Panel Metal Roofs
Common in agricultural buildings, workshops, and some modern homes, these roofs feature wavy or ribbed profiles. They are often less expensive than standing seam. Performance against hail: The corrugations add significant strength, making these roofs quite robust against hail. Thicker gauge panels (e.g., 26-gauge) will perform better. Dents are still possible, particularly on the flatter sections of the ribs, but generally, the structural integrity remains intact.
Metal Shingles and Shakes
Designed to mimic traditional asphalt shingles, wood shakes, or slate tiles, these are individual metal panels stamped into various shapes. They often come with textured finishes. Performance against hail: Metal shingles, typically made from lighter gauge steel or aluminum, are generally less resistant to denting than standing seam or corrugated panels. The individual panel design means impacts are localized. However, they still far outperform asphalt shingles in terms of avoiding cracking or granule loss. Dents can be more noticeable due to their flat, shingle-like appearance.
What to Expect When Metal Roofs and Hail Collide
It’s crucial to have realistic expectations about how metal roofs and hail interact. While metal roofs are tough, they aren’t completely impervious to every impact. Understanding the potential outcomes helps you assess damage accurately.
Cosmetic vs. Functional Damage
This is a key distinction.
- Cosmetic damage refers to dents or dings that affect the appearance of the roof but do not compromise its ability to shed water or protect your home. These are common with larger hailstones.
- Functional damage, on the other hand, involves punctures, cracks, or severe deformation that could lead to leaks, corrosion, or structural issues. Functional damage from hail on a well-installed, appropriate-gauge metal roof is rare but not impossible, especially with extremely large hailstones or poor installation.
The vast majority of hail damage to metal roofs falls into the cosmetic category.
Understanding “Oil Canning” and Dents
“Oil canning” is a term for visible waviness or distortion in flat metal panels. It’s often inherent in large, flat metal surfaces and can be exacerbated by stress or thermal expansion. Hail impact can certainly contribute to or highlight oil canning, especially if dents are widespread.
Dents are the most common visible result of hail on metal roofs. Their size and depth depend on the hailstone size, impact velocity, and the metal’s gauge and type. A quarter-sized hailstone might leave a small, shallow dent, while golf-ball-sized hail could create noticeable depressions.
The Myth of Total Immunity
While metal roofs are highly durable, it’s a myth that they are totally immune to hail damage. Even the thickest metal can dent under extreme impact. The goal of a metal roof is to resist damage that would compromise its function and lifespan, not necessarily to remain aesthetically flawless after every storm. Your roof’s ability to protect your home from the elements is its primary job, and metal excels at this even with some cosmetic dents.
Post-Hail Storm Inspection: What DIYers Can Do Safely
After a hailstorm, the first thing you’ll want to do is check for damage. While a professional inspection is always recommended for comprehensive assessment, there are safe steps a DIYer can take from the ground.
Safety First: Gear and Precautions
Your safety is paramount. Never compromise it for a roof inspection.
- Assess from the ground first. Use binoculars for a closer look.
- If you must go on the roof, use extreme caution. Wear slip-resistant shoes.
- Use a sturdy ladder and ensure it’s properly secured.
- Never go on a wet or icy roof. Wait until it’s completely dry.
- Consider a harness and safety rope if you’re working on a steep pitch. If you’re not comfortable or experienced, hire a professional.
Ground-Level Assessment
Start by walking around your home. Look for obvious signs of damage not just on the roof but also on gutters, downspouts, siding, windows, and outdoor furniture. These can indicate the size and intensity of the hail.
On the roof, use binoculars to scan for:
- Visible dents: Look for circular depressions, especially on flatter panels or ribs.
- Missing fasteners: Though rare, extreme hail could potentially loosen or damage exposed fasteners on certain roof types.
- Peeling or chipped coatings: While not structural, hail can sometimes chip paint or coatings.
- Damage to other roof components: Check skylights, vents, and chimney caps for dents or cracks.
Closer Look (If Safe and Necessary)
If you feel confident and the roof pitch is low and dry, you might carefully ascend. Bring a camera or smartphone to document any findings.
- Feel for irregularities: Gently run your hand over suspicious areas to feel for dents not immediately visible to the eye.
- Measure dents: If possible, place a ruler or coin next to larger dents for scale in photos.
- Check seams: Ensure all seams are still tightly interlocked and haven’t separated.
Documenting Potential Damage
Take clear, well-lit photos and videos of any damage you find. Include wide shots of the roof and close-ups of specific dents. This documentation is crucial if you need to file an insurance claim. Note the date of the storm and your inspection.
Repairing Hail Damage on Metal Roofs: When to DIY vs. Call a Pro
Finding dents on your metal roof after a storm can be disheartening. The decision to tackle repairs yourself or call in a professional depends on the extent and type of damage.
Minor Cosmetic Fixes
For purely cosmetic dents that don’t affect the roof’s integrity, some DIYers might consider options like paintless dent repair (PDR) techniques, similar to those used on cars. This involves specialized tools to gently push or pull the dent out from the underside.
- Consider your skill level: PDR requires finesse and practice. Improper technique can worsen the dent or damage the coating.
- Accessibility: You need access to the underside of the panel, which is often impossible without dismantling sections of the roof.
- Coating damage: If the dent has chipped the protective coating, you’ll need to clean, prime, and repaint the area to prevent rust. Matching paint colors can be tricky.
For most homeowners, minor cosmetic dents are often best left alone, as their repair can sometimes be more costly or damaging than the dent itself.
Structural Integrity and Leaks
If you suspect functional damage—a puncture, a cracked panel, or a compromised seam—do not attempt a DIY repair unless you have extensive roofing experience.
- Punctures: These require professional patching or panel replacement to ensure watertightness.
- Compromised seams: Leaking seams need expert resealing or re-crimping.
- Large, deep dents: If dents are significant enough to affect drainage or create pooling, a professional roofer should assess the situation.
Any damage that could lead to water intrusion is a serious issue. Water leaks can quickly cause much more expensive damage to your home’s structure, insulation, and interior.

Maintaining Your Metal Roof for Long-Term Resilience
While metal roofs are known for their low maintenance, a little proactive care goes a long way in ensuring they remain robust against future storms and other environmental factors. Proper maintenance helps prolong the life of your roof and ensures it’s always ready to protect your home, regardless of how metal roofs and hail interact.
Regular Cleaning and Debris Removal
Keep your metal roof free of debris like leaves, branches, and dirt. Accumulations can trap moisture, promote corrosion, and even scratch the surface.
- Gentle cleaning: Use a soft-bristle brush and a garden hose. Avoid high-pressure washers, which can damage coatings or force water under seams.
- Clear gutters: Ensure your gutters and downspouts are clear to allow for proper water drainage. Clogged gutters can cause water to back up onto the roof, potentially leading to issues.
- Trim overhanging branches: While metal roofs resist punctures better than shingles, heavy branches falling during a storm can still cause significant damage. Trimming them back reduces this risk.
Coating and Sealant Checks
Periodically inspect your roof’s protective coatings and sealants, especially around penetrations like vents, pipes, and skylights.
- Look for fading or peeling: While aesthetic, significant fading or peeling coatings can indicate a loss of UV protection, which might eventually lead to material degradation.
- Check sealants: Over time, sealants around seams and penetrations can dry out, crack, or shrink. These areas are vulnerable points for water intrusion. Reapply high-quality, exterior-grade sealants as needed.
- Fastener integrity: For exposed fastener systems, check that all screws are tight and that their rubber washers are still intact and sealing properly. Replace any rusted or deteriorated fasteners.

Frequently Asked Questions About Metal Roofs and Hail
Will my metal roof void my insurance if it gets hail damage?
No, having a metal roof will not void your insurance for hail damage. In fact, many insurance companies offer discounts for homes with metal roofs due to their superior durability and resistance to perils like hail and fire. However, the specific terms of your policy regarding cosmetic damage versus functional damage will apply, just as they would for any roofing material.
Are some metal roof colors better for hiding hail damage?
Yes, lighter colors and roofs with textured finishes or complex panel profiles tend to hide cosmetic hail dents better than dark, smooth, flat panels. A matte finish or a roof with a variegated color can also make minor dents less noticeable. Dark, glossy, flat panels will show dents more prominently.
How can I improve my metal roof’s hail resistance?
The best way to improve hail resistance is by choosing the right materials from the start. Opt for a thicker gauge metal (e.g., 24-gauge steel), a standing seam profile, or a ribbed panel design. Proper installation by experienced professionals is also crucial. Once installed, regular maintenance, like clearing debris and checking sealants, ensures the roof remains in optimal condition to withstand future storms.
